使用Linux搭建VPN服务器:一步步教你如何实现。(linux做vpn服务器)

如今,越来越多的人都关注使用VPN服务器来保护个人隐私和安全,让自己的网络活动受到更强的保护。其中,Linux是非常有用的,它可以帮助您搭建VPN服务器,一步步教你如何实现。所以,本文将深入探索Linux上如何搭建VPN服务器,让你可以更好地明白这一过程。

首先,搭建VPN服务器需要在Linux操作系统上安装OpenVPN服务器。为此,我们需要先在服务器上安装OpenVPN服务器软件包。对于不同的Linux发行版,这一步可能略有不同,但这里我们以Ubuntu为例。

使用apt-get命令安装OpenVPN服务器软件包:

# apt-get install openvpn

接下来,要配置VPN服务器的网络和安全功能,需要在服务器节点上创建OpenVPN配置文件。这里,我们创建一个叫做“myVPN.conf”的文件,将其添加到服务器节点上:

port 1080
proto tcp
dev tun
ca ca.crt
cert server.crt
key server.key
dh dh2048.pem
server 10.8.0.0 255.255.255.0
ifconfig-pool-persist ipp.txt
keepalive 10 120

上述就是OpenVPN服务器的配置文件,接下来需要为其创建证书,安全认证的关键步骤就在这里。有不少方式可以实现,但最简单的方法是使用“Easy-RSA”工具,来生成客户端和服务器的证书与私钥:

#!/bin/bash
# Set up easy-rsa
EASY_RSA="/usr/share/easy-rsa/3.0.6"
# source the vars file
source $EASY_RSA/vars
# Build the certificate
./easyrsa build-client-full

最后,使用以下命令启动OpenVPN服务器:

# systemctl start openvpn@myvpn.service

以上操作完成之后,就可以正常使用Linux上搭建的VPN服务器了。

本文详细介绍了如何使用Linux搭建VPN服务器的过程,从安装OpenVPN软件到使用Easy-RSA工具生成证书以及最后启动OpenVPN服务器,一步步教你如何在Linux上实现。上面的步骤只是简单的概述,如果想知道更多信息,建议专业人员仔细阅读相关文档。此外,本文还介绍了如何使用Linux搭建VPN服务器,以及如何为其创建证书,它将有助于加强您对此过程的理解。


数据运维技术 » 使用Linux搭建VPN服务器:一步步教你如何实现。(linux做vpn服务器)